Roadrunner Venture Studios is a company creation factory. We co-found breakthrough deep-tech ventures with the nation’s most brilliant scientists, engineers, and innovators in Energy, Space, Clean Tech, Advanced Materials and Manufacturing, Quantum, and High Performance Computing. Our team gets involved at the earliest possible moment — often when a company is just a whiteboard scribble, a concept modeled in wire-frame, or as founders are puzzling through how to design a pitch deck or process payroll — and rapidly accelerates product development, commercialization, and recruitment. We are the ultimate company “starter-kit,” equipping our portfolio companies with everything they need to go from the kernel of an idea to a venture-backed growth engine. Our promise is clear: our founders leave our studio with a company, a check, a customer, and a team.

Had the opportunity to attend RTF24 hosted by Roadrunner Venture Studios in Albuquerque this week. Walked away with new knowledge regarding the importance of the involvement of private, state, and federal agencies in the innovation of deep tech, how so many are working to grow the entrepreneurial ecosystem in NM, and above all else take the risks. I heard this multiple times throughout the day that we need to take the risk and invest in deep tech companies, they won’t always meet the typical investment criteria so they need to be evaluated with a slightly different set of metrics. Thanks to everyone who attended #RTF24 and to Roadrunner Venture Studios for making all of it possible! We enjoyed having the opportunity to join hundreds of fellow members of the deep tech community in Albuquerque, New Mexico for a day of exploring cutting-edge advancements and emerging areas in technology. Anzu Managing Partner Whitney Haring-Smith participated in a panel that delved into the state of deep tech investing, including the importance of thinking beyond short-term trends, the increasing role government plays in venture funding, artificial intelligence, quantum computing, autonomous vehicles and more. It was great seeing Anzu portfolio companies BioFlyte, Inc., Nature's Toolbox, Inc. (NTx), Voltaiq and XGS Energy there as well. Tons of thanks to Alice Brooks, partner with Bay Area-based Khosla Ventures, for sitting down ahead of last week's Roadrunner Venture Studios technology forum to talk technology and venture capital in New Mexico. One takeaway from the convo? The state is flush with, in Brooks' words, "researchers working on really cool things" — exactly what tech-focused venture firms like Khosla look for, she said. https://lnkd.in/gdrxa5vY
